Output 42938b758aa53bde4e51bf232812890ebf88a1b23cf74dfb37540719eafb4ca0:3

value
12627340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3aca5a7da1f0460afed39baf4fe9c8561ec0e0 OP_EQUAL
address
3P8o9TNbnR5HVTGABByeZi7VEXVvgJqR2Q
transaction
42938b758aa53bde4e51bf232812890ebf88a1b23cf74dfb37540719eafb4ca0